vps建站图文教程,VPS主机建站全攻略,从选购到部署,带你轻松搭建网站
- 综合资讯
- 2025-03-18 00:54:20
- 2

本图文教程全面解析VPS主机建站过程,涵盖选购、部署等关键步骤,助您轻松搭建个人网站。...
本图文教程全面解析VPS主机建站过程,涵盖选购、部署等关键步骤,助您轻松搭建个人网站。
随着互联网的快速发展,越来越多的企业和个人开始关注网站建设,而VPS主机作为网站建设的首选服务器,因其稳定、安全、灵活等特点受到广泛青睐,本文将为您详细讲解VPS主机建站的全过程,包括选购、配置、部署等环节,帮助您轻松搭建属于自己的网站。
VPS主机选购指南
硬件配置
(1)CPU:根据网站规模和访问量选择合适的CPU,一般建议选择2核以上,4核及以上更为理想。
(2)内存:内存大小直接影响网站运行速度,建议选择4GB以上,8GB及以上更为合适。
图片来源于网络,如有侵权联系删除
(3)硬盘:硬盘类型分为SSD和HDD,SSD读写速度快,但价格较高;HDD价格低,但读写速度慢,根据预算和需求选择合适的硬盘类型。
(4)带宽:带宽大小影响网站访问速度,建议选择1Mbps以上,5Mbps及以上更为理想。
操作系统
VPS主机支持多种操作系统,如Windows、Linux等,根据您的需求选择合适的操作系统,Linux系统免费、开源,且性能稳定,适合大多数网站;Windows系统则更适合需要使用微软软件的企业。
服务商选择
选择信誉良好、口碑较高的VPS主机服务商,确保主机稳定、安全,以下是一些知名VPS主机服务商:
(1)阿里云
(2)腾讯云
(3)华为云
(4)UCloud
(5)Vultr
VPS主机配置
远程连接
使用SSH客户端(如Xshell、PuTTY等)连接到VPS主机,输入用户名和密码。
更新系统
在终端输入以下命令,更新系统:
sudo apt-get update
sudo apt-get upgrade
安装软件
根据网站需求,安装相应的软件,以下列举一些常用软件及其安装命令:
(1)Apache服务器
sudo apt-get install apache2
(2)MySQL数据库
sudo apt-get install mysql-server
(3)PHP
sudo apt-get install php
sudo apt-get install php-mysql
(4)Nginx
图片来源于网络,如有侵权联系删除
sudo apt-get install nginx
网站部署
域名解析
在域名服务商处添加域名解析,将域名指向VPS主机的公网IP地址。
文件传输
使用FTP客户端(如FileZilla、WinSCP等)将网站文件上传到VPS主机。
配置网站
根据网站类型,配置相应的网站文件,以下列举一些常见网站配置方法:
(1)Apache服务器
编辑Apache配置文件(/etc/apache2/sites-available/000-default.conf),修改DocumentRoot和ServerName。
(2)Nginx服务器
编辑Nginx配置文件(/etc/nginx/sites-available/default),修改root和server_name。
数据库配置
在MySQL数据库中创建数据库和用户,并将用户授权给数据库。
网站优化
缓存
安装缓存插件,如Apache的mod_cache、Nginx的ngx_cache_purge等,提高网站访问速度。
压缩
使用Gzip压缩网站文件,减少文件大小,提高访问速度。
SEO优化
根据搜索引擎优化(SEO)原则,优化网站结构和内容,提高网站排名。
通过以上步骤,您已经成功搭建了一个属于自己的网站,在实际运营过程中,关注网站性能、安全,定期更新内容和维护,才能使网站持续发展,希望本文对您有所帮助!
本文链接:https://www.zhitaoyun.cn/1820329.html
发表评论